Job Viewed
Job Description
The Job Description
- Maintaining backup and disaster recovery procedure and replication in all recovery sites.
- Administer Azure DR solution using recovery services.
- Configure Azure AAD and AD connect servers with High availability.
- Configure APP proxy, MFA, SSPR and SSO to secure on-prem/cloud services.
- Administering, monitoring, configuring, and securing VMware vSphere ESXi clusters in multiple data centers.
- Implementing, configuring, and monitoring various new system projects.
- Monitor system performance and troubleshoot issues promptly.
- Managing Windows Server infrastructure components (Active Directory, DNS, DHCP, File share and Exchange).
- Patching & managing Infrastructure & cloud vulnerabilities.
- Daily operation, monitoring and troubleshooting system health, data center activities, server firmware upgrade and maintenance periodically.
- Applying data restore procedure and document test recovery cases.
- Proactively monitor systems health by physically inspecting environment and utilizing the provided monitoring tools such as SCOM.
- Storage configuration & troubleshooting.
- Managing AD Policies and meet security compliance.
Qualifications:
- Minimum Qualification: Bachelor’s in computer science or a related field.
- Minimum Work Experience: Min of 10+ years of experience.
- Certification: Azure Administrator Associate and expert. Microsoft Certified Systems Engineer.
- Level of English: Excellent in both reading and writing.

Job Description
- Install, configure, and maintain Sun Solaris servers and related hardware.
- Manage and optimize Solaris zones, containers, and LDOMs.
- Implement and monitor system performance metrics, identifying and addressing bottlenecks.
- Ensure systems adhere to security policies by implementing best practices, patches, and updates.
- Conduct regular audits and vulnerability assessments.
- Manage enterprise backup solutions and ensure data integrity and recovery readiness.
- Develop and maintain disaster recovery plans and conduct regular testing.
- Configure and maintain network services such as DNS, NFS, and SSH.
- Troubleshoot and resolve network issues related to Solaris servers.
- Develop scripts for automation of administrative tasks and system monitoring.
- Implement configuration management using tools like Ansible or Puppet.
- Provide Level 2/3 support for issues related to Solaris systems.
- Work with other teams to resolve cross-platform issues involving Solaris servers.
- Create and maintain system documentation, including runbooks, processes, and configuration details.
- Prepare periodic reports on system performance and security status.
- Work closely with storage, network, and database teams to ensure optimal integration and operation
